About Sandra Rico's service

I am a Licensed Mental Health Counselor and Certified Sex Therapist. I have 16 years of experience treating people suffering from a wide range of problems including family problems, relationship problems, parenting issues, depression, anxiety, and sexual disorders. I gained a Bachelor’s Degree in Social Science at Florida State University in 2005, where I learned about people of various cultures. I continued my studies in Florida International University to earn a Master of Science with a major in Psychology, and became a Certified Sex Therapist in 2008. I utilize techniques learned in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Solution Focused Therapy, and Client Centered Therapy to assist people in developing tools to improve their lives. I will provide guidance by helping you develop your goals and treatment plan so that you can take control of your life.
